Top definition
A deep dive into the popular video-hosting site, YouTube. The longer and weirder the time spent on the site is, the more accurate the term becomes.
Person 1: Hey, how's your exam studying going?
Person 2: I was all set in the morning, but I accidentally took a YouScuba instead... I can tell you all about the history of memes now though.
by Nam Elcsum June 14, 2018
Get the mug
Get a YouScuba mug for your Aunt Helena.